Ingredients List
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ened – Make sure it’s nice and soft for easy mixing; it helps create that creamy texture we all love.
- 1 cup vanilla yogurt – I prefer using a thicker yogurt for a richer dip, but any vanilla yogurt will do!
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ar – This adds just the right amount of sweetness; feel free to adjust if you like it sweeter.
- 1 tsp vanilla extract – Always use pure vanilla extract if you can; it enhances the flavor beautifully.
- 1/2 tsp cinnamon – This is a secret touch that adds warmth and depth to the dip; it’s a game changer!

Step 1: Combine Ingredients
First things first, grab a mixing bowl and toss in that softened cream cheese and your cup of vanilla yogurt. You really want the cream cheese to be soft so it blends effortlessly with the yogurt. Using a hand mixer or a sturdy spoon, mix them together until they’re smooth and creamy. Trust me, the more you blend, the better the texture will be! Aim for a thick and velvety consistency that just begs to be dipped into.
Step 2: Add Flavorings
Once your cream cheese and yogurt are perfectly combined, it’s time to add in the fun stuff! Sprinkle in the powdered sugar, pour in the vanilla extract, and add that glorious cinnamon. Now, mix it all together until everything is well incorporated and smooth. You want each element to shine through, so don’t rush this part! Just keep mixing until there are no lumps left, and the dip is utterly delightful.
Step 3: Serve or Store
Now that your dip is ready, you have two options: dig in right away or store it for later! If you’re serving it right away, grab your favorite fresh fruits and let the dipping begin! If you want to save it for later, just pop it in an airtight container and refrigerate. It’ll stay fresh for about three days, but I doubt it’ll last that long once everyone gets a taste! Just remember to give it a quick stir before serving again, and enjoy the creamy goodness!

Tips for Success
Before you dive into making this delicious fruit dip, here are a few pro tips that will help you achieve the best results! Trust me, these little nuggets of wisdom go a long way in making your dip turn out perfectly every time.
- Use room temperature ingredients: Make sure your cream cheese is at room temperature for easy mixing. If you forget to take it out, just pop it in the microwave for a few seconds—just be careful not to melt it!
- Mixing method matters: For a super smooth dip, I recommend using a hand mixer. It really helps to whip everything together nicely and eliminates any lumps. A sturdy whisk works too, but it’ll take a bit more elbow grease.
- Adjust sweetness to your taste: Everyone has different preferences, so feel free to tweak the powdered sugar to make it sweeter or less sweet. Just taste as you go—it’s all about finding your perfect balance!
- Chill for a bit: If you have time, let the dip chill in the fridge for about 30 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ld together beautifully, making it even more delicious.
- Don’t skip the cinnamon: I know it might seem like a small detail, but that sprinkle of cinnamon really elevates the flavor. Trust me, it’s worth it!

FAQ Section
Can I use different types of yogurt?
Absolutely! You can switch it up with Greek yogurt for a thicker texture, or even try a flavored yogurt if you want to add a twist. Just remember that the flavor of the dip may change slightly depending on what you choose!
What can I substitute for cream cheese?
If you’re looking for a lighter option, you can use whipped cream cheese or even a non-dairy cream cheese alternative. Just keep in mind that the flavor and texture might vary a bit, but it’ll still be delicious!
How long does the fruit dip last in the fridge?
This dip can be stored in the refrigerator for up to three days. Just make sure to keep it in an airtight container to maintain its freshness. It might thicken a bit while sitting, so give it a good stir before serving again!
Can I make this dip ahead of time?
Yes! This dip is perfect for making a day or two in advance. Just whip it up, store it in the fridge, and you’ll have a quick and easy snack ready to go when you need it!
What if I don’t like cinnamon?
No problem! You can easily leave out the cinnamon or substitute it with a pinch of nutmeg or even a little cocoa powder for a chocolatey twist. Feel free to customize it to your taste!
Can I freeze the fruit dip?
I wouldn’t recommend freezing it, as the texture may change once thawed. It’s best enjoyed fresh, but you can definitely keep it in the fridge for a few days as mentioned!
What fruits pair best with this dip?
You can’t go wrong with classic choices like strawberries, apples, and bananas. But don’t be afraid to get creative! Try it with peaches, pineapple, or even a refreshing fruit salad. The possibilities are endless!
Fruit Dip: 10 Minutes to a Creamy Delight You’ll Love
- Total Time: 10 minutes
- Yield: 2 cups 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A creamy and delicious fruit dip that pairs well with a variety of fresh fruits.
Ingredients
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up vanilla yogurt
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 tsp cinnamon
Instructions
- In a mixing bowl, combine softened cream cheese and vanilla yogurt.
- Mix in powdered sugar, vanilla extract, and cinnamon until smooth.
- Serve immediately or refrigerate for later use.
Notes
- Best served with fresh fruits like strawberries, apples, and bananas.
- Can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
